In Vance and the surrounding Mississippi Delta region, professional installation typically ranges from $3 to $12 per square foot, heavily dependent on material choice. Labor for basic laminate or vinyl plank is on the lower end, while hardwood, tile, or intricate patterns cost more. Key local factors include the need for a moisture barrier due to our high humidity and potential subfloor adjustments in older homes common to the area, which can add to the project cost.
Vance's high humidity and potential for moisture from the Yazoo River basin soil make moisture management critical. We strongly recommend using a high-quality vapor barrier and acclimating materials like solid hardwood in your home for several days before installation. Engineered wood, luxury vinyl plank (LVP), or tile are often more stable choices here, as they are less prone to warping and expansion with our seasonal humidity swings.
Late fall and early winter (October through February) are often ideal for installation in Mississippi, as lower humidity levels allow for more stable conditions, especially for wood products. Summers are challenging due to peak heat and humidity, which can affect material behavior and adhesive curing times. However, professional installers in Vance are experienced in managing these conditions year-round with proper climate control inside the home.

For standard residential flooring replacement, a permit is generally not required in Vance or unincorporated Sunflower County. However, if the project is part of a larger renovation that involves altering the home's structure or electrical/plumbing systems, a permit may be needed. Always check with the Sunflower County Building Department for confirmation.
